1package i18n
2
3// This file contains plural rule implementations for different languages.
4// Plural rules are based on Unicode CLDR plural rules.
5// Reference: https://cldr.unicode.org/index/cldr-spec/plural-rules
6
7// EnglishPlural implements plural rules for English.
8// Rule: one (n == 1), other (everything else)
9func EnglishPlural(n int) PluralForm {
10 if n == 1 {
11 return One
12 }
13 return Other
14}

34// FrenchPlural implements plural rules for French.
35// Rule: one (n == 0 or n == 1), other (everything else)
36func FrenchPlural(n int) PluralForm {
37 if n == 0 || n == 1 {
38 return One
39 }
40 return Other
41}

52// RussianPlural implements plural rules for Russian.
53// Rule: one (n mod 10 == 1 and n mod 100 != 11)
54//
55// few (n mod 10 in 2..4 and n mod 100 not in 12..14)
56// many (everything else)
57func RussianPlural(n int) PluralForm {
58 mod10 := n % 10
59 mod100 := n % 100
60
61 if mod10 == 1 && mod100 != 11 {
62 return One
63 }
64 if mod10 >= 2 && mod10 <= 4 && (mod100 < 12 || mod100 > 14) {
65 return Few
66 }
67 return Many
68}

70// ArabicPlural implements plural rules for Arabic.
71// Rule: zero (n == 0)
72//
73// one (n == 1)
74// two (n == 2)
75// few (n mod 100 in 3..10)
76// many (n mod 100 in 11..99)
77// other (everything else)
78func ArabicPlural(n int) PluralForm {
79 if n == 0 {
80 return Zero
81 }
82 if n == 1 {
83 return One
84 }
85 if n == 2 {
86 return Two
87 }
88
89 mod100 := n % 100
90 if mod100 >= 3 && mod100 <= 10 {
91 return Few
92 }
93 if mod100 >= 11 && mod100 <= 99 {
94 return Many
95 }
96 return Other
97}

111// PolishPlural implements plural rules for Polish.
112// Rule: one (n == 1)
113//
114// few (n mod 10 in 2..4 and n mod 100 not in 12..14)
115// many (everything else)
116func PolishPlural(n int) PluralForm {
117 if n == 1 {
118 return One
119 }
120
121 mod10 := n % 10
122 mod100 := n % 100
123
124 if mod10 >= 2 && mod10 <= 4 && (mod100 < 12 || mod100 > 14) {
125 return Few
126 }
127 return Many
128}
129
130// CzechPlural implements plural rules for Czech.
131// Rule: one (n == 1)
132//
133// few (n in 2..4)
134// many (everything else)
135func CzechPlural(n int) PluralForm {
136 if n == 1 {
137 return One
138 }
139 if n >= 2 && n <= 4 {
140 return Few
141 }
142 return Many
143}
